libarchive 2.0
* libarchive_test program exercises many of the core features * Refactored old "read_extract" into new "archive_write_disk", which uses archive_write methods to put entries onto disk. In particular, you can now use archive_write_disk to create objects on disk without having an archive available. * Pushed some security checks from bsdtar down into libarchive, where they can be better optimized. * Rearchitected the logic for creating objects on disk to reduce the number of system calls. Several common cases now use a minimum number of system calls. * Virtualized some internal interfaces to provide a clearer separation of read and write handling and make it simpler to override key methods. * New "empty" format reader. * Corrected return types (this ABI breakage required the "2.0" version bump) * Many bug fixes.

+#include "test.h"
+__FBSDID("$FreeBSD$");
+
+static unsigned char testdata[10 * 1024 * 1024];
+static unsigned char testdatacopy[10 * 1024 * 1024];
+static unsigned char buff[11 * 1024 * 1024];
+
+/* Check correct behavior on large reads. */
+DEFINE_TEST(test_read_large)
+{
+ int i;
+ int tmpfile;
+ char tmpfilename[] = "/tmp/test-read_large.XXXXXX";
+ size_t used;
+ struct archive *a;
+ struct archive_entry *entry;
+
+ for (i = 0; i < sizeof(testdata); i++)
+ testdata[i] = (unsigned char)(rand());
+
+ assert(NULL != (a = archive_write_new()));
+ assertA(0 == archive_write_set_format_ustar(a));
+ assertA(0 == archive_write_open_memory(a, buff, sizeof(buff), &used));
+ assert(NULL != (entry = archive_entry_new()));
+ archive_entry_set_size(entry, sizeof(testdata));
+ archive_entry_set_mode(entry, S_IFREG | 0777);
+ archive_entry_set_pathname(entry, "test");
+ assertA(0 == archive_write_header(a, entry));
+ assertA(sizeof(testdata) == archive_write_data(a, testdata, sizeof(testdata)));
+#if ARCHIVE_API_VERSION > 1
+ assertA(0 == archive_write_finish(a));
+#else
+ archive_write_finish(a);
+#endif
+
+ assert(NULL != (a = archive_read_new()));
+ assertA(0 == archive_read_support_format_all(a));
+ assertA(0 == archive_read_support_compression_all(a));
+ assertA(0 == archive_read_open_memory(a, buff, sizeof(buff)));
+ assertA(0 == archive_read_next_header(a, &entry));
+ assertA(0 == archive_read_data_into_buffer(a, testdatacopy, sizeof(testdatacopy)));
+#if ARCHIVE_API_VERSION > 1
+ assertA(0 == archive_read_finish(a));
+#else
+ archive_read_finish(a);
+#endif
+ assert(0 == memcmp(testdata, testdatacopy, sizeof(testdata)));
+
+
+ assert(NULL != (a = archive_read_new()));
+ assertA(0 == archive_read_support_format_all(a));
+ assertA(0 == archive_read_support_compression_all(a));
+ assertA(0 == archive_read_open_memory(a, buff, sizeof(buff)));
+ assertA(0 == archive_read_next_header(a, &entry));
+ assert(0 < (tmpfile = mkstemp(tmpfilename)));
+ assertA(0 == archive_read_data_into_fd(a, tmpfile));
+ close(tmpfile);
+#if ARCHIVE_API_VERSION > 1
+ assertA(0 == archive_read_finish(a));
+#else
+ archive_read_finish(a);
+#endif
+ tmpfile = open(tmpfilename, O_RDONLY);
+ read(tmpfile, testdatacopy, sizeof(testdatacopy));
+ close(tmpfile);
+ assert(0 == memcmp(testdata, testdatacopy, sizeof(testdata)));
+
+ unlink(tmpfilename);
+}
